/********************************************************************** * File:        serialis.h  (Formerly serialmac.h) * Description: Inline routines and macros for serialisation functions * Author:      Phil Cheatle * Created:     Tue Oct 08 08:33:12 BST 1991 * * (C) Copyright 1990, Hewlett-Packard Ltd. ** Licensed under the Apache License, Version 2.0 (the "License"); ** you may not use this file except in compliance with the License. ** You may obtain a copy of the License at ** http://www.apache.org/licenses/LICENSE-2.0 ** Unless required by applicable law or agreed to in writing, software ** distributed under the License is distributed on an "AS IS" BASIS, ** W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. ** See the License for the specific language governing permissions and ** limitations under the License. * **********************************************************************/#ifndef SERIALIS_H#define SERIALIS_H#include          <stdlib.h>#include          <string.h>#include          <stdio.h>#include "memry.h"#include "errcode.h"#include "fileerr.h"/* **************************************************************************These are the only routines that write/read data to/from the serialisation."serialise_bytes" and "de_serialise_bytes" are used to serialise NON classitems.  The "make_serialise" macro generates "serialise" and "de_serialise"member functions for the class name specified in the macro parameter.************************************************************************** */extern DLLSYM void *de_serialise_bytes(FILE *f, int size); extern DLLSYM void serialise_bytes(FILE *f, void *ptr, int size); extern DLLSYM void serialise_INT32(FILE *f, INT32 the_int); extern DLLSYM INT32 de_serialise_INT32(FILE *f); extern DLLSYM void serialise_FLOAT64(FILE *f, double the_float); extern DLLSYM double de_serialise_FLOAT64(FILE *f); extern DLLSYM UINT32 reverse32(            //switch endian                               UINT32 num  //number to fix                              );extern DLLSYM UINT16 reverse16(            //switch endian                               UINT16 num  //number to fix                              );/***********************************************************************  QUOTE_IT   MACRO DEFINITION  ===========================Replace <parm> with "<parm>".  <parm> may be an arbitrary number of tokens***********************************************************************/#define QUOTE_IT( parm ) #parm#define make_serialise( CLASSNAME )													\																									\	NEWDELETE2(CLASSNAME)                                                 \																									\void						serialise(														\	FILE*					f)																	\{																								\	CLASSNAME*			shallow_copy;													\																									\	shallow_copy = (CLASSNAME*) alloc_struct( sizeof( *this ) );				\		memmove( shallow_copy, this, sizeof( *this ) );								\																									\	shallow_copy->prep_serialise();													\		if (fwrite( (char*) shallow_copy, sizeof( *shallow_copy ), 1, f ) != 1)\		WRITEFAILED.error( QUOTE_IT( CLASSNAME::serialise ),              \									ABORT, NULL );											\																									\	free_struct( shallow_copy, sizeof( *this ) );								\		this->dump( f );																			\}																								\																									\	static CLASSNAME*		de_serialise(										\	FILE*					f)																	\{																								\	CLASSNAME*			restored;											\																									\		restored = (CLASSNAME*) alloc_struct( sizeof( CLASSNAME ) );				\		if (fread( (char*) restored, sizeof( CLASSNAME ), 1, f ) != 1)				\		READFAILED.error( QUOTE_IT( CLASSNAME::de_serialise ),            \									ABORT, NULL );												\																									\	restored->de_dump( f );																	\		return restored;																			\}#endif
